First Day of Dealings on AIM

 

TechFinancials, Inc. ("TechFinancials", the "Company" or the "Group"), a software developer, supplying simplified trading solutions to online brokers, and operator of its own online brokerage, is pleased to announce the commencement at 08.00 a.m. today of dealings in its Ordinary Shares on AIM, a market operated by the London Stock Exchange plc. Grant Thornton UK LLP is acting as Nominated Adviser to the Company, Northland Capital Partners Limited as Broker and Argento Capital Markets Limited are acting as Financial Adviser respectively. The Company's ticker is TECH.

 

The Company, together with Northland Capital Partners Limited, successfully raised approximately £3.05 million (before expenses) through the issue of 11,304,709 new ordinary shares at a price of 27 pence per ordinary share (the "Fundraising"). TechFinancials' market capitalisation on admission, based on the placing price, is approximately £ 18.4 million.

 

The net proceeds of the Fundraising will be used in part to help grow the TechFinancials Group businesses and brand globally by investing in the continued development of the Group's regulatory compliant solutions for the US and Japanese markets, and the further development of the Group's solutions in the EU market as well investing in additional marketing activities which will help increase global brand awareness. Additionally part of the proceeds will be used to help strengthen the Group's balance sheet and to provide additional working capital as the Group will evaluate corporate development activity opportunities such as join ventures and/or acquisitions.

History and Background

TechFinancials was formed in 2009 by Asaf Lahav, Eyal Rosenblum, Eyal Alon and Jeremy Lange, a group of four experienced senior executives with technology, FOREX and online marketing backgrounds. Their vision was to create an innovative "simplified trading solution" which could be utilised by online brokers to provide a platform for retail customers to trade in Binary Options. The Group's platform is based on a proprietary pricing engine, which enables online brokers to price and market short-term Binary Options and Exotic Options.

 

The Group launched a beta version of its platform with two online brokers; OptionFair, the Group's own online regulated broker, and www.24option.com, the largest Binary Option broker in the world today, in April and July 2010, respectively. The Group subsequently launched a live version of the platform in January 2011. In September 2010 the Group completed its first investment round, raising US$750,000.

 

The Group began generating revenues from both of its business units in 2011 and reported total revenues of US$3.8 million for the year ended 31 December 2011. B.O. TradeFinancials was incorporated in Cyprus in order to run OptionFair as a regulated business under the supervision of the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ission ("CySEC"). In September 2013 B.O. TradeFinancials obtained its CIF licence from CySEC. During 2013, the Group invested in growing its online broker customer base as a result of which licences the TechFinancials software to brands operated by online brokers, including OptionFair and www.24option.com. Currently, around 18% of all deposits which are made to trade Binary Options globally are processed using the Group's software.

 

During H1 2014, TechFinancials began to focus on the Asian market, securing distribution in Japan and China. The Group has experienced substantial growth, with revenues of almost US$7.2 million in H1 2014, an increase of approximately 100% compared to H1 2013.

 

Binary Options

A Binary Option, which is sometimes referred to as an "all-or-nothing option", is an option that pays either a fixed amount or nothing at all, depending on whether a certain condition is fulfilled when the option expires. By contrast, traditional or "Vanilla" options can have a range of outcomes. An option referenced to the price of a particular share, for example, will be worth the difference between the share price at expiry and the option exercise price. A Binary Option would return a fixed amount to investors only if the share price reached a specified strike price at expiry and would return nothing if the share price did not reach that specified strike price. The payoff of a Binary Option contract is fixed and pre-determined so the potential risk and reward is known from the outset.

 

The Directors believe that Binary Options are one of the fastest growing traded instruments because they are simple to understand and straightforward to trade. The Directors also believe that they are suited to retail customers who do not require or necessarily have in-depth knowledge of the financial markets in order to trade and, in addition, Binary Options can serve as a gateway to more professional financial trading products such as FOREX.

 

 

TechFinancials' Business

TechFinancials' operates through two business units:

 

1) TechFinancials

The Group was created to establish an innovative simplified trading solution to be licensed to online brokers targeting retail customers. These solutions are designed to provide ease of use for the end user as well as providing a complete operating solution for online brokers. The Group's current product range comprises its simplified Binary Options platform and its simplified FOREX platform. Currently, TechFinancials' core product is a Binary Options trading platform accompanied by a suite of back office modules and applications such as risk management and CRM.

 

TechFinancials targets online marketers or online media businesses looking to diversify into online broking. The end-user interface is designed to interact with the pricing engine and the back-office modules. The TechFinancials platform is able to process trades automatically and synchronises in real time with the relevant back-office modules such as the customer accounts database and the trade monitoring software. Online brokers and their customers are able to monitor open positions and trading activity continuously.

 

The Group's proprietary pricing engine allows online brokers licencing the TechFinancials software to limit their financial risk as a result of the complex algorithms that calculate the strike price of the Binary Options and the nature of Binary Options themselves.

 

In H2 2014, TechFinancials launched its second trading platform, simplified FOREX, in beta version, with the final product expected to go live in 2015. In addition, the Group expects to launch full versions of the following products during 2015:

 

• a pricing engine for fixed strike Binary Options for US regulated exchanges;

• a fixed strike Binary Options trading platform with supporting IT systems for retail brokers planning to operate in Japan; and

• a simplified CFD trading platform through which traders will be able to trade CFDs on stocks.

 

The Group intends to expand its product offering further and has developed a multi-asset platform (also known as a multi-dealer platform) which will combine a range of trading instruments onto one trading platform, allowing retail customers to trade different instruments, such as Binary Options and FOREX, via a simple and unified user interface.

 

2) OptionFair

The Group's own online broker, OptionFair (www.OptionFair.com), operates as a broker regulated by CySEC since September 2013. It serves retail customers based principally in Europe. Launched in 2010, OptionFair was one of the first online Binary Options brokers to be established and offers Binary Options referenced to a wide range of financial instruments and assets. OptionFair utilises the technology developed by TechFinancials and also assists TechFinancials in trialing and evaluating products that it has under development.

 

OptionFair is now one of the leading EU regulated online Binary Options brokerages, generating revenues of US$4.1 million in H1 2014, an increase of approximately 160% compared to H1 2013. This growth was achieved by concentrating on multiple European markets, with a particular focus on the Eastern European market. In addition, in October 2014 OptionFair started to offer TechFinancials' new simplified FOREX trading platform in beta mode to a number of its customers.

 

The Group plans to use some of the proceeds from the Placing for OptionFair to enter new regulated markets which the Directors believe have significant growth potential, such as the US and Japan.

Market

The simplified Binary Options market was first introduced in 2008 by etrader.co.il and has since experienced significant growth, both in number of online brokers operating in the market and trading volumes. Using the ForexMagnates Report estimates of global deposits in 2014 and 2016 of US$1.26 billion and US$2.76 billion, respectively, and the OptionFair deposits to volume traded ratio, the Directors believe the global trading of Binary Options will reach approximately US$13.61 billion for 2014 and US$29.81 billion in 2016.

 

The Directors believe that the growth of the Binary Options market, which reflects the growth shown by the FOREX market around ten years ago, is being driven by, inter alia:

• organic growth in Europe, which is currently the world's leading market for Binary Options;

• the entry of additional US Binary Options exchanges;

• the adoption of new regulations in Japan; and

• the penetration of Binary Options into the Chinese market

 

The Directors believe that as the online trading market becomes better established and subject to increased regulation, larger and better known financial organisations will enter the Binary Options market.
